December 3, 2009 NFR:TSX.V PR #09 19 Northern Freegold Extends Gold Mineralization in Step Out Drilling to the Southwest of the Nucleus Zone at Freegold Mountain, Yukon Vancouver, BC: December 3, 2009. Northern Freegold Resources Ltd. (NFR: TSX V) is pleased to provide results from 6 additional drill holes in the Nucleus Zone at the district scale road accessible Freegold Mountain Project, located in the Yukon. In 2009, a total of 10,440 m were completed within 44 drill holes in the Nucleus Zone, where an initial inferred gold resource of 1.082 million ounces was announced 1. The Nucleus Zone is a bulk tonnage, potentially openpittable intrusion related gold mineralized system. The 6 holes fall within the large scale northwest trending brittle shear zone, identified from the 2009 field program, and first documented in the Nov. 19, 2009 release. Highlights: Highlights from holes within this release include (see attached map): Hole 153: 3.74 m of 4.43 g/t gold including 0.37 m of 38.70 g/t gold; and 1.80 m of 11.30 g/t gold Hole 149: 12.84m of 0.81 g/t gold and 31.85m of 0.56 g/t gold Hole 150: 6.49 m of 1.47 g/t gold These holes were drilled in the same area of the brittle shear zone outlined in the previous news release and continue to expand mineralization to the south and southwest of the Nucleus The northwest trending brittle shear zone, identified by integrating historical geophysical surveys, geological mapping and diamond drilling, is part of a large shear system within the Freegold Mountain Project. The brittle shear zone has the potential to host mineralization as seen by the following significant results returned from earlier holes from 2008 2 and 2009 3 such as Hole 111: 7.90 m of 25.33 g/t gold and 2.55 m of 49.70 g/t gold Hole 113: 3.60 m of 55.27 g/t gold including 0.73 m of 142.00 g/t gold Hole 128: 1.31 m of 11.50 g/t gold and 25.38 m of 1.25 g/t gold Hole 144: 4.47 m of 9.68 g/t gold and 17.10 m of 1.01 g/t gold Hole 147: 2.27 m of 10.05 g/t gold, 0.42 m of 51.40 g/t gold & 2.00m of 9.68 g/t gold The Nucleus zone remains open in all directions and at depth. 1 (67.67 million tonnes @ 0.5 g/t gold with a 0.3 g/t cutoff; see news release dated July 27, 2009). 2 see news release dated March 26, 2009; 3 see news releases dated Oct. 22, 2009 and Nov. 19, 2009

Drill sections and a 3D visualization can be viewed at ww.corebox.net or by following a link on the company s website at www.northernfreegold.com Sampling Methodology, Quality Control and Assurance The holes were drilled by a skid mounted diamond drill with NTW core size (5.6 cm/2.2 inches in diameter). Core samples from diamond drilling were split and sent to both EcoTech Laboratory in Whitehorse for sample preparation and then to EcoTech Laboratory in Kamloops for analysis, as well as to ALS Chemex Laboratory in North Vancouver for sample preparation and analysis. Blanks, commercial standards and duplicate core samples were included in each batch. To determine Au levels at the ppb level (detection limit 5 1000 ppb (10,000 ppb at ALS)) 30 g samples were fire assayed then digested in aqua regia solution and analyzed by atomic absorption. Values over 1,000 ppb are re assayed by fire assay and then digested with aqua regia and then re analyzed by an atomic absorption instrument (detection limit 0.03 g/t) at EcoTech, or re assayed by fire assay followed by a gravimetric finish at ALS. Other elements are analyzed by a 29 elements (33 at ALS) package (ICP AES analysis). Additional check analyses are carried out by the lab which did not receive the original sample. Intervals reported in this release do not necessarily represent true widths of mineralization. The technical information disclosed in this release has been reviewed and approved by Wade Barnes, P. Geo. About the Freegold Mountain Project The road accessible Freegold Mountain Project is located 200 km northwest of Whitehorse, the capital of the Yukon and is situated within an active exploration and mining area called the Tintina Gold Belt. NFR controls 166 square km (64 square miles) within the district scale Freegold Mountain Project, containing at least 20 identified mineralized zones, including the Nucleus, Revenue and Tinta. Nearby projects include the producing Minto Mine of Capstone Mining Corp. the Casino and Carmacks Copper Deposits of Western Copper Corporation, and the White Gold Property of Underworld Resources to the northwest.

The Freegold Mountain Project is well situated within the stable, mining supportive jurisdiction of the Yukon which has a single assessment approach for developing projects The Freegold Mountain Project is located within the traditional territories of two settled First Nations: Little Salmon Carmacks First Nation and the Selkirk First Nation. The Freegold Mountain Project is located on the Freegold Road, a government maintained gravel road that connects to the Klondike Highway, an all weather paved highway leading to Whitehorse. Powerlines along the Klondike Highway are 30 km from the Freegold Project boundary. Other projects in the Tintina Gold Belt are the producing Fort Knox mine operated by Kinross Gold and the recently discovered Livengood Project of International Tower Hill Mines Ltd., both located in Alaska. The open pit Fort Knox mine contains proven and probable resources of 252.8 Mt at an average grade of 0.47 g/t gold as of December 31, 2008 (www.kinross.com). These reserves and resources have not been verified by the qualified person and the information is not necessarily indicative of the mineralization at Freegold Mountain.
